I generally start with a free pattern to make a test piece and then alter it for a final custom piece.
The last 2 photos are of a Covid-era project which I designed and made 100% custom for my oldest son. I wanted to make him a ‘quilt’ by hand, putting love and support into each of the hand-crocheted ~9,600 stitches. This has been my magnum opus thus far, especially challenging because it’s made in horizontal stitch rows with color changes shown on my hand sketched pattern. I didn’t have a ladder of the right size to fit in the frame due to ceiling height. Finished quilt is 94x106 inches.
